Join the Commercial Real Estate Alliance of San Diego (CRASD) for an exclusive behind-the-scenes tour of HP Investors' latest project in the heart of Solana Beach!
In June 2022, HP Investors acquired the former Bank of America building, located at the prime corner of Hwy 101 and Dahlia Drive. This 8,296 SF commercial property was transformed into the company’s new headquarters. Be among the first to witness the evolution of this iconic space.

Measure A, appearing on the June 2 ballot, proposes a new tax on residential properties that are not occupied as a primary residence for more than half the year.
While it is presented as a housing solution, many in our industry and local community have raised concerns about its potential impact.
Here’s what you should know:
No guarantee funding is dedicated to housing — revenue would go into the City’s General Fund without restriction
Will increase costs for homeowners, renters, and housing providers
Creates a new layer of regulation and administrative oversight
Will impact property rights and how homeowners use their properties

New proposed rental housing regulations in the City and County of San Diego could have significant implications for REALTORS®, housing providers, property owners, and investors across our region.
As these proposals continue to evolve, it’s important for real estate professionals to stay informed on how potential changes may impact rental operations, property management practices, housing supply, and long-term investment strategies.
To help members better understand these developments, SDAR is sharing an upcoming educational webinar presented by the California Apartment Association (CAA):
REALTORS® in the Know: Policy Alert
Proposed Rental Housing Regulations in San Diego
This free webinar will provide insight into:
Proposed rental housing regulations currently being discussed
How these policies may affect rental property owners and housing providers
Potential impacts on rental businesses and investment properties
Key considerations for REALTORS® working with landlords, investors, and clients throughout San Diego County
